Blacker's Art of Fly Making, &c

Enriched edition. Comprising Angling, & Dyeing of Colours, with Engravings of Salmon & Trout Flies

2022

EN

In "Blacker's Art of Fly Making, &c," W. Blacker brings forth a meticulously detailed exploration of angling, focusing specifically on the craft of fly making. With a blend of practical guidance and artistic expression, Blacker delves into the techniques that define the creation of various fly patterns, elucidating the delicate interplay between natural materials and the whims of the angler's art. The book is steeped in rich Victorian sensibilities, showcasing a literary style that marries...

“The Fly-Fisherman's Entomology” is a complete handbook on fly fishing, first published in 1836. Dealing with everything from required equipment to the habits and habitats of fish, this volume will be of considerable utility to those looking to get into the wonderful pastime of fly fishing. Also includes chapters on technique, common problems and overcoming them, making the flies, and much more.
